Summary
The transcript explores the Vietnamese dish Bun Cha, a famous Hanoi specialty that is challenging to find authentically prepared outside its original city. The narrator details the key components of a perfect Bun Cha, including fresh vermicelli noodles, two types of meat (meatballs and pork belly), a sweet and sour broth, and crisp herbs and spring rolls. Despite being in Da Nang, the speaker discovers a restaurant that offers a high-quality, true-to-origin version of the dish, highlighting the importance of fresh ingredients and regional culinary expertise. The video concludes by emphasizing the incredible value of the meal, which costs only $2 and provides a satisfying, balanced lunch.
